Eternal Whispers: A Love Beyond the Grave



Love and horror intertwine in the haunting town of Ravens Hollow, where the line between life and death is blurred. When Ethan moves into the ancient Blackwood Manor, he never expects to fall in love with a woman who exists beyond the veil of mortality. As their passion deepens, so does the horror surrounding them, forcing them to defy fate in a terrifying yet beautiful romance that transcends time itself.

Chapter One: The Arrival at Blackwood Manor

Ethan Carter was never one for superstitions. A struggling writer, he sought solitude in the mysterious town of Ravens Hollow, drawn by the allure of an abandoned estate known as Blackwood Manor. Local legends spoke of eerie whispers, flickering candlelights in the windows, and a tragic love story that ended in bloodshed centuries ago.

Ignoring the warnings, Ethan moved in, finding the mansion eerily preserved despite its age. The cold autumn air sent shivers down his spine as he explored the grand halls, dust particles dancing in the candlelight. But the true horror began that night when he heard a voice—soft, melodic, and sorrowful—calling his name.


Chapter Two: The Woman in the Portrait

Ethan found an old portrait in the study, depicting a breathtaking woman with raven-black hair and piercing silver eyes. Her name was Isabella Blackwood, the former lady of the manor. Intrigued, Ethan researched her past and discovered a dark tale.

Centuries ago, Isabella had fallen in love with a man named Gabriel, a commoner who was deemed unworthy by her noble family. Their love was forbidden, and when her father discovered their affair, he ordered Gabriel’s execution. In her grief, Isabella cursed the mansion before taking her own life, vowing to find Gabriel again in another lifetime.

That night, Ethan awoke to cold fingers tracing his cheek. He gasped, finding himself face to face with Isabella—the woman from the portrait. "You came back to me… Gabriel," she whispered.


Chapter Three: A Love Reawakened

Ethan, initially terrified, couldn’t deny the magnetic pull between him and Isabella. She appeared only at night, her presence ghostly yet heartbreakingly real. She recounted her past with longing, and despite knowing the danger, Ethan found himself falling in love.

As days turned into weeks, the boundary between the living and the dead blurred. He danced with her under the moonlight, their love rekindling a passion centuries in the making. But with love came the whispers—warnings from unseen forces. The spirits of Blackwood Manor did not wish for Isabella to find peace, nor did they intend to let Ethan go.


Chapter Four: The Curse Unfolds

The more time Ethan spent with Isabella, the more sinister the house became. Objects moved on their own, shadows lurked in the corners, and ominous voices whispered in his ear, "Leave while you still can."

One night, an unseen force dragged Ethan from his bed. The spirits of Isabella’s vengeful ancestors materialized, enraged at his presence. "You cannot break the curse!" they bellowed, attempting to tear him from her. But Isabella stood defiant, her ghostly form glowing with an unnatural light. "I will not lose him again!" she screamed, shattering the spirits into dust.


Chapter Five: A Choice Between Worlds

As their love grew, so did the danger. The house fed on Ethan’s soul, pulling him closer to death with every night spent in Isabella’s arms. She wept, knowing that if he stayed, he would perish and be trapped with her forever.

"You must leave before it’s too late," she pleaded. But Ethan refused. "I love you, Isabella. I’d rather die than live without you."

Torn between his mortality and his love, Ethan sought the help of a local medium. She revealed a horrifying truth—Ethan was Gabriel’s reincarnation. If he chose to stay, he would relive Gabriel’s fate, forever bound to Blackwood Manor’s curse.


Chapter Six: Breaking the Curse

With time running out, Ethan and Isabella performed a forbidden ritual to sever the curse. As they chanted under a blood moon, the spirits of her ancestors returned, fighting to keep their hold on Isabella’s soul.

"You cannot have her!" they roared.

Ethan, despite his fear, embraced Isabella, their love forming a radiant light that shattered the darkness. The spirits shrieked as the curse broke, releasing Isabella from her eternal prison. But there was a price—Ethan collapsed, his body growing cold.


Chapter Seven: Love Beyond Death

Ethan awoke in a hospital bed days later, the manor reduced to ruins. He was alive, but Isabella was gone. Heartbroken, he returned to the site one last time, whispering her name into the wind.

As he turned to leave, a gentle breeze caressed his cheek, and a familiar voice whispered, "I will always love you." He smiled, knowing that though they were separated by worlds, their love would never die.
